Diesel price at the pump has gone up 3 cents to a national average of $2.69 a gallon. Crude oil prices have stayed about the same at $63.05 a barrel. The price has not fluctuated much despite the rise in winter heating oil. This begs the question of why fuel prices have gone up.

Mercedes S420 V8 Diesel Debut - 320hp and 538ft-lbs!
December 6th, 2006
Press Release - Stuttgart, Dec 06, 2006
Mercedes-Benz is extending its S-Class range with another diesel variant, the S 420 CDI. The new eight-cylinder model is powered by a state-of-the-art V8 CDI engine developing 235 kW/320 hp and 730 newton metres of peak torque. This latest addition to the model line-up means that the luxury saloon range from Mercedes-Benz now encompasses two diesel engines, six petrol models and two body variants, along with the new 4MATIC all-wheel-drive system. The new S 420 CDI is available to order now, with deliveries to customers due to start in December 2006. The short-wheelbase model is priced at € 84,448 (net price € 72,800) and the long-wheelbase version at € 92,104 (net price € 79,400).
